Simon's Simulations,[1] also known as the Dungeon-Simulation Game,[2] is a Mini-Game run by Simon in The Minish Cap.

Location

Located in Hyrule Town's central plaza, Simon will open his green, ghost-topped building to the public after Link has completed the Fortress of Winds.

Rules

After paying 10 Rupees to play,[3] Link will be instructed to fall asleep in the bed provided by the shop. The young hero will "awaken" to find himself in a square, Dungeon-like room filled with an assortment of monsters, including Moblins, Keatons, and Peahats.[4] Link must destroy all of the monsters in order to receive a Piece of Heart, as a reward. Despite it being a simulation, Link dies if he loses all his Hearts rather than waking up. Link may return to play the mini-game at any time during his quest; however, the prizes range from Rupees to Hearts after subsequent, successful playthroughs.[5]
